Soil Packing 101: How Vibrating Machines Work

Ramming compactors are a common tool for compressing earth. They work by exerting a strong vibration and force to read more the area of the material . This process causes the earth particles to compact closer together, reducing air pockets and increasing the compaction . The pad of the compactor , which can range in size , quickly vibrates, constantly hitting the ground and pushing the particles to bind . Finally , this creates a more firm and well-compacted base for paving or other projects .
